Optimizing Clinical Trials with Electronic Data Capture

Managing data effectively is one of the biggest challenges in clinical trials. Traditional methods of data collection, such as paper-based forms, often lead to inefficiencies, errors, and delays. Electronic data capture systems provide a modern solution, enabling research teams to streamline data collection, improve accuracy, and enhance collaboration across study sites.

What is electronic data capture?

Electronic data capture (EDC) refers to a digital system used to collect, manage, and store clinical trial data. Instead of relying on manual processes, researchers use an EDC platform to enter data directly into a secure database. This not only reduces the likelihood of errors but also simplifies the process of monitoring and analyzing data throughout the study.

Streamlining data collection

One of the primary advantages of an EDC system is its ability to streamline data collection. Clinical trials often generate vast amounts of data from multiple sites, making traditional methods prone to delays and inaccuracies. With EDC, data can be entered directly into the system in real time, ensuring that it is immediately accessible to authorized team members.

Additionally, the structured design of EDC forms ensures consistency in data entry, reducing discrepancies and making it easier to analyze information across sites. This streamlined approach saves time and minimizes the risk of incomplete or inconsistent data.

Improved accuracy and data integrity

Manual data entry processes are inherently error-prone, especially when dealing with large volumes of information. Electronic data capture systems include built-in validation checks that flag errors or inconsistencies as soon as they are detected. This allows research teams to address issues immediately, ensuring that the collected data is accurate and reliable.

Moreover, by centralizing data in a single platform, EDC systems eliminate the need for redundant entries or transfers between systems. This not only improves accuracy but also simplifies audits and reviews by providing clear and consistent records.

Enhanced collaboration across teams

Collaboration is a key component of successful clinical trials, especially those involving multiple sites and stakeholders. An EDC system provides a centralized platform where team members can access and update information in real time. This fosters better communication and ensures that everyone has the latest data at their fingertips.

With the ability to grant controlled access to specific users, EDC platforms also ensure that sensitive data remains secure while still allowing seamless collaboration among authorized personnel.

A scalable solution for modern research

As clinical trials grow in size and complexity, managing data effectively becomes even more critical. EDC systems are highly scalable, allowing research teams to adapt to the demands of larger studies without compromising efficiency or organization. Whether managing a single-site trial or a global multi-site study, EDC provides the flexibility needed to handle increasing volumes of data and participants.
